Mac's Old House is the sort of place any redneck would recognize instantly. Converted to a bar and grill from a residence, it is quite popular with the biker and trucker crowds, and naturally it is a bit rough around the edges as a result. Mac's features a full bar stocked with the major brands of liquors, but it also has two rooms for lunches and family dinners.
The dinner menu has few items, but all are nicely done, with soup and salad a standard include. Mac's does what it can to create a family atmosphere for dinner time in a rough place, not an easy task to begin with.
$12.00 per person is sufficient budget in most cases, but be advised that Mac's is a cash-only establishment.
